Output 434aa632919608b7a051142583dd3b88ece365175ed44cb3a3990eca4944e3ef:45

value
193045446
script pubkey
OP_0 OP_PUSHBYTES_20 58500f0a66a24941cebf817074a63f66666f412e
address
bc1qtpgq7znx5fy5rn4ls9c8ff3lvenx7sfwsyeyhu
transaction
434aa632919608b7a051142583dd3b88ece365175ed44cb3a3990eca4944e3ef
spent
false

63 Sat Ranges